Faith & Spirit Quote by Julia Cameron

"Each of us has an inner dream that we can unfold if we will just have the courage to admit what it is. And the faith to trust our own admission. The admitting is often very difficult"

About this Quote

Cameron’s line doesn’t romanticize dreaming; it interrogates the bureaucracy of self-deception that keeps most people safely “aspirational” and permanently stalled. The punch is in her verbs: unfold, admit, trust. This isn’t about inventing a new desire, it’s about recognizing an existing one and then surviving the social and psychological consequences of naming it.

“Inner dream” sounds soft until you notice how quickly she turns it into a test of character. Courage here isn’t bold action; it’s the quieter bravery of stating, without irony, what you want. That admission threatens the little bargains that make adult life feel stable: the respectable job, the plausible excuses, the identity you’ve already been rewarded for performing. Cameron is basically saying the first hurdle isn’t talent or opportunity, it’s honesty - the kind that collapses your alibis.

Then she twists the knife: you also need “faith to trust our own admission.” Even if you confess the dream, you can still disqualify it by treating it as a phase, a fantasy, or something you’ll “get to later.” Faith becomes a discipline of taking yourself seriously when no one else is required to. The final sentence, blunt and almost weary, lands like a writer’s aside from someone who has watched people circle their desires for years. In Cameron’s broader context - The Artist’s Way ethos, creativity as spiritual practice - admitting is a threshold ritual. Say it out loud, and you’re no longer innocent. You’re responsible.
